Remove unshelve handler from novaclient wrapper

We haven't been using unshelve since the old instance reservation plugin
was removed, and this method has been available in novaclient for years
anyway.

Change-Id: I5294b888b29dc408b063a98e708d240341c3e770
This commit is contained in:
Sam Morrison 2019-12-18 11:17:45 +11:00 committed by Pierre Riteau
parent 9cef00c2ad
commit b82a1c32cf
1 changed files with 0 additions and 12 deletions

View File

@ -162,19 +162,7 @@ class BlazarNovaClient(object):
return getattr(self.nova, name)
# TODO(dbelova): remove these lines after novaclient 2.16.0 will be released
class BlazarServer(servers.Server):
def unshelve(self):
"""Unshelve -- Unshelve the server."""
self.manager.unshelve(self)
class ServerManager(servers.ServerManager):
resource_class = BlazarServer
def unshelve(self, server):
"""Unshelve the server."""
self._action('unshelve', server, None)
def create_image(self, server, image_name=None, metadata=None):
"""Snapshot a server."""